EuroMillions National Lottery Winner Still In Hiding
Last updated: 13/03/2008 16:58
The Irish winner of the biggest win in European lottery history has still not come forward to claim her prize, lottery officials have confirmed.
"Despite widespread publicity naming Dolores McNamara, a housewife from Limerick, as the holder of the winning ticket, Paula McEvoy of the National Lottery said nobody had been in contact.
Ms McEvoy said: "But bear in mind the winner has 90 days from Friday to collect their prize. We are hoping the winner will make contact today. There is quite a buzz around the office everyone is anticipating winners or anyone coming in. It really is nice that the prize has gone to Ireland."
Ms McEvoy said she would not be surprised if Ms McNamara fails to claim her winnings for several days.
